I got my S3 LTE AW on launch day last year. There was a promotion that waived the activation fee and first three months of the line service fee. I went to activate my S4 LTE yesterday through Verizon, but it very clearly stated to me that I would be charged a $30 upgrade fee. You can call your carrier to see if you can convince them to drop the fee, but YMMV.
 
In Canada I’m on Bell, and when switching from cellular Series 3 to Series 4 I got this nice little surprise. Essentially a $10 fee to swap SIM from one watch to the next. Overall can’t complain given that Bell is $5/month for cell service and else where I see it at $10/month and up.
